ora-12154 TNS:"无法处理服务名"的一个解决方法

http://www.cnblogs.com/xh3/archive/2007/04/21/722217.html

很怪异的一个问题,在网络环境下配置客户端,竟然怎么也连不上主机了,看了不少帖子,大多数都是修

改tnsnames.ora文件中的配置,但试了很多也不行,最后打开了sqlnet.ora中的文件发现了问题所在,

# SQLNET.ORA Network Configuration File: f:\oracle\ora90\network\admin\sqlnet.ora

# Generated by Oracle configuration tools.

SQLNET.AUTHENTICATION_SERVICES= (NTS)

NAMES.DIRECTORY_PATH= (TNSNAMES, ONAMES, HOSTNAME)

原来是少写了“TNSNAMES, ONAMES”这两个属性,仔细想了下为何出这样的问题,后来明白是在Net Configuration Assistant中配置命名方法时,少选了这两项内容,如下图所示:

时间: 2024-08-04 12:44:47

ora-12154 TNS:"无法处理服务名"的一个解决方法的相关文章

vs自动生成的WebService配置文件在部署到IIs6后,服务调用失败的解决方法

近日,在项目中需要引用java发布的WebService,添加服务引用后,调用一切正常. 配置如下: <system.serviceModel> <bindings> <basicHttpBinding> <binding name="SecurityServiceImplServiceSoapBinding" maxBufferPoolSize="2147483647" maxReceivedMessageSize=&qu

ora-12154 TNS:无法处理服务名疑难处理

折腾了几天的PLSQL,终于解决这个问题,在此分享给需要的朋友 服务器:WindowsServer2008(64位操作系统).Win7(64位操作系统) Oracle版本:10.2.0 问题:安装完Oracle后NetManger测试成功,PLSQL安装完毕连接数据库后显示ora-12154 TNS:无法处理服务名 如同网上说的:监听程序重启.Listener配置.oraname配置都是正常的,ping配置的数据库也可以ping通 最后在网上找到一条说:安装的路径中不能有括号 原来我的PLSQL

cmd中输入net start mysql 提示:服务名无效常见解决办法

解决方法:请进入MySQL的bin目录,并在bin目录打开命令行窗口,在命令行窗口输入:mysqld --install,回车,提示:Service successfully installed.表示安装MySQL服务成功,命令行窗口输入:net start mysql ,可以正常启动 原文地址:https://www.cnblogs.com/ruan-ruan/p/11626192.html

Win7系统中MySQL服务无法启动的解决方法

Win7系统中提示:本地无法启动MySQL服务,报的错误:1067,进程意外终止的解决方法.在本地计算机无法启动MYSQL服务错误1067进程意外终止.这种情况一般是my.ini文件配置出错了1.首先找到这个文件: Win7下的默认安装路径C:\ProgramData\MySQL\MySQL Server 5.6\my.ini打开此文件找到:default-storage-engine=INNODB将default-storage-engine的值改为:MYISAM.2.但是还有问题:因为以前你

转: apache服务无法启动的解决方法

~~~把apache安装为服务myweb,用apacheMonitor启动myweb发现无法启动,提示:the requested operation has failed ~~~通过下面的方法排查 发现 httpd-vhosts.conf配置文件 documentRoot: "f:\lm\" 这里应该用正斜杠 f:/lm/ Apache不能启动解决办法 这是我这两天频繁遇到的问题.Apache服务器还真是问题少年!任何点改动都可能导致它无法使用. 原因一:80端口占用例如IIS,另外

虚拟机部署度量快速开发平台服务端出现ora-27101错误的一个解决方法

最近在使用hyper-v虚拟机部署系统总出现的一个数据库错误,部署情况如下:1.把之前现有的一个服务端环境的hyper-v停止,拷贝出去vhd文件2.建立新的虚拟机,选择拷贝出去的文件3.启动新的虚拟机,并更改虚拟机的计算机名称,修改oracle数据库的监听和服务名.4.重启oracle的实例和监听.5.连接到数据库,发现报告以下错误:Error:ORA-01034:Oracle not availableORA-27101:shared memory realm dose not exists

RHCS集群 服务不能正常启动 解决方法

对于初次搭建 RHCS 集群 总是遇到 很多 意想不到的 trouble. 用 luci  管理 集群时 : 在  搭建  server group  服务  ,服务出现 disable  那是 常有的时.. 下面给出  我在 练习中 解决 方法.. 1.无 法 在 Fence 或 者 重 启 后 重 新 加 入 集 群 的 节 点:  重启 rgm anager 捕获应用程序 core 前,请移动或删除 / 目录中的所有旧 core 文件.应重启出现rgm anager 崩溃的集群节点,或者在

【Mongodb教程 第一课补加课2 】MongoDB下,启动服务时,出现“服务没有响应控制功能”解决方法

如图,如果通过下列代码,添加服务后,使用net start命令出现这样的问题时,可以参考下我的解决方法. D:\MongoDB>mongod --dbpath D:\MongoDB\Data --logpath D:\MongoDB\Log\MongoDB.log --logappend --serviceName MongoDB --auth --install 解决方法: 出现这个问题一般是路径有问题. 1)请注意你所有的路径没有错,包括mongod所在路径,日志所在路径等: 2)不要加入多

Oracle在更改机器名后服务无法启动的解决方法

Oracle改变机器名后会导致服务无法正常启动,可以通过下列操作解决: 1.oracle\product\10.2.0\db_3\network\ADMIN目录下,listener.ora文件中的LISTENER 改为你的新机器名,如果有域名的话加上域名: tnsnames.ora中ORCL改为你的新机器名,如果有域名的话加上域名: 2.oracle\product\10.2.0\db_3\下有个以你"旧机器名_orcl"为文件名的文件夹,把旧机器名改为新的名字 3.oracle\pr